site stats

Rocketmq transactionlistener

Web25 Jul 2024 · RocketMQ Client Go A product ready RocketMQ Client in pure go, which supports almost the full features of Apache RocketMQ, such as pub and sub messages, ACL, tracing and so on. Due Diligence Here, we sincerely invite you to take a minute to feedback on your usage scenario. Features For 2.0.0 version, it supports: sending … WebRocketMQ入门 基础概念 #那些场景要用到消息队列(重点) 有3大重要作用: 解耦: 例如用户完成下单除了必要的库存扣减和订单状态更新外,我们还需要处理一些积分系统、推送系统 …

RocketMQ study notes (10)-RocketMQ Producer transaction …

WebThis paper introduces source tracking related to transaction messages in version 4.5.0 of RocketMQ, which can be known by reading: What problems do transaction messages solve. ... transactionListener executes local transaction if send succeeds. Executes the endTransaction method, telling the server to delete a half-message if the half-message ... Web10 Apr 2024 · 前言 消息队列 RocketMQ 版是基于 Apache RocketMQ 构建的低延迟、高并发、高可用、高可靠的分布式 消息中间件。 消息队列 RocketMQ 版既可为 分布式 应用系统提供异步解耦和削峰填谷的能力,同时也 具备互联网应用所需的海量消息堆积、高吞吐、可靠 … trend fast track mk2 sharpener https://robertgwatkins.com

org.apache.rocketmq.client.producer.TransactionMQProducer …

Web首先在init ()方法中初始化了transactionListener和发生RocketMQ事务消息的变量producer。 - createOrder () 真正提供创建订单服务的方法,根据请求的参数创建一条消息,然后调用 … WebThe following examples show how to use org.apache.rocketmq.client.producer.TransactionMQProducer.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. Web9 Apr 2024 · RocketMQ 事务消息原理 依赖于 TransactionListener 接口实现 executeLocalTransaction() 在发送消息后调用,用于执行本地事务,如果本地事务执行成功,RocketMQ 再提交消息 Producer 发送消息给 MQ 后,MQ会回调这个方法,开发者在该方法中编写事务逻辑,执行成功后 MQ 会将消息提交 checkLocalTransaction() 用于检查事 … trend fashion terbaru

RocketMQ Series --- Transaction Message - Programmer Sought

Category:Apache RocketMQ with Spring Boot Baeldung

Tags:Rocketmq transactionlistener

Rocketmq transactionlistener

分布式事务 - mq 实现原理 - 《学习笔记》 - 极客文档

WebThe rocketmq transaction message occurs between Producer and Broker and is a two-phase commit. Producer, the first stage ensures that the message is sent successfully; The second stage performs a local operation, which determines whether the message sent needs to be consumed or rolled back based on the results of the local operation. Web10 Jan 2024 · TransactionListener not found · Issue #31 · apache/rocketmq-spring · GitHub TransactionListener not found #31 Closed lwanqiang opened this issue on Jan 10, 2024 · …

Rocketmq transactionlistener

Did you know?

Web1、RocketMq生产者组(producer group)的设定有什么用? 2、一个订单处理的场景,消费者订阅了订单topic,但总担心丢消息。于是为了防止丢消息,每天都会通过定时任务做 … Web15 Dec 2024 · 目录前言流程地图源码跟踪核心模块(消息拉取)拉取流程拉取消息处理当pullStatus为FOUND,消息进行提交消费的请求消息消费进度提交总结前言上一篇文章中我们主要来看RocketMQ消息消费者是如...目录前言流程地图源码跟踪核心模块(消息拉取)拉取流程拉取消息处理当pullStatus为FOUND,消息进行提交 ...

WebFrom Rocketmq 4.0 to now the latest V4.7.1, whether it is in Alibaba or an external community, it has won extensive attention and praise. For the need for interest and work, I recently studied some code of RocketMq 4.7.1, and there was a lot of confusion between them and gain more inspiration. http://www.tuohang.net/article/266961.html

WebRocketMQ's transaction message is the event that sends a message and other events that need to succeed or fail simultaneously. A common scenario: an order is paid and a coupon is sent to the user. ... InterruptedException { TransactionListener transactionListener = new TransactionListenerImpl(); TransactionMQProducer producer = new ... WebRocketMQ入门 基础概念 #那些场景要用到消息队列(重点) 有3大重要作用: 解耦: 例如用户完成下单除了必要的库存扣减和订单状态更新外,我们还需要处理一些积分系统、推送系统的无关紧要的业务处理,如果全部顺序执行,等待时间就会变得很漫长,所以我们需要借助MQ将边角业务从业务模块中解耦 ...

Web24 May 2024 · Hello, I Really need some help. Posted about my SAB listing a few weeks ago about not showing up in search only when you entered the exact name. I pretty much do …

Web16 Dec 2024 · 上篇文章,介绍了RocketMQ消息类型支持事务消息,常见用在分布式系统中,保证数据的一致性。 接下来一起去走进 TransactionMQProducer … trend fashion styleWeb29 Jun 2024 · 3, Transaction message implementation process 1. Implementation process In brief, the transaction message is a listener with a callback function. In the callback function, we perform business logic operations, such as giving the account - 100 yuan, and then sending a message to the integral mq. template powerpoint biologiaWebsyntax: res, err = p:setTransactionListener(transactionListener) transactionListener is a table that contains two functions as follows: executeLocalTransaction(self, msg, arg) … template powerpoint bankWeb11 Apr 2024 · RocketMQ事务消息的使用. 使用事务消息需要实现自定义的事务监听器, TransactionListener 提供了本地事务执行和状态回查的接口, executeLocalTransaction … template powerpoint biologyWebTwo methods of TransactionListener. executeLocalTransaction. Half messaging successfully triggered this method to perform local transactions. checkLocalTransaction. Broker will send a check message to check the transaction status, and call this method to get the local transaction status. Local transaction execution status. … trend featuresWeborigin: apache/rocketmq } else if (transactionListener != null) { log.debug( "Used new transaction API" ); localTransactionState = transactionListener. executeLocalTransaction … trend fast trackWeb25 Apr 2024 · RocketMQTemplate 里加入了一个发送事务消息的方法 sendMessageInTransaction(),并且最终这个方法会代理到 RocketMQ 的 TransactionProducer 进行调用,在这个 Producer 上会注册其关联的 TransactionListener 实现类,以便在发送消息后能够对 TransactionListener 里的方法实现进行调用。 3. trend feature